The Department of Mechanical and Aerospace Engineering at West Virginia University seeks applications for Research Assistant Professor in Materials Science (Position #51201). Applicants must hold a doctorate in Materials Science with minimum three year experience in surface/interaction electrochemistry and anode/cathode development for coal based fuel SOFC, and minimum one year experience in ceramic thermoelectric material development and characterization.
Review of applications will begin on June 1, 2012 and will continue until the position is filled. Electronic applications are required and should be sent to MAEDept@mail.wvu.edu including a cover letter with Position #51201, a CV, and contact information for three references.
West Virginia University is a comprehensive land-grant institution with an enrollment of over 29,000; a Carnegie High Research University at the center of a developing high-technology corridor, providing challenges and opportunities for candidates. The Department is ranked top 25 in research expenditures by the National Science Foundation. It employs 30 tenure-track faculty and offers B.S., M.S., and Ph.D. degrees in both Mechanical and Aerospace Engineering to 450 undergraduate students, 80 M.S., and 75 Ph.D. students.
